Process FTIR Spectrometer for Hazardous Environments

Keit`s IRmadillo™ in situ FTIR spectrometer Receives ATEX certification.

Keit has announced receipt of ATEX and IECEx certification for its rugged IRmadillo™ Fourier Transform Infrared (FTIR) spectrometer. Dan Wood, CEO, stated: “The certification assures our clients that our analytical instrument has been rated safe for use in hazardous environments including potentially explosive ones. This is a requirement for industries such as in Oil & Gas, Petrochemicals and Pharmaceuticals where the processes involve potentially explosive chemicals.”

Industrial Process Analytical Technology (PAT)

Dan stated: “In industrial environments, the toughness of PAT should go hand in hand with its function. It should work dependably regardless of the environment. We’ve proven with the IRmadillo™, that it can be accomplished with FTIR spectroscopy.” Dan explained: “FTIR is an established and powerful technique for the analysis of chemical reactions. FTIR can tell you a lot about what’s going on in your process as it happens - in real time. However, most standard FTIR instruments rely on sensitive moving parts, fibre-optic coupling, and are extremely vulnerable to shock and vibrations which makes them impractical for production environments. Often, manufacturers have to wait for their reaction analysis because they are doing remote sampling and lab analysis.”

Rugged Analytical Instrument

Dan Wood continued: “The IRmadillo™ FTIR spectrometer is unlike any other. We knew that it could handle a lot. It is vibration tolerant, compact and tough, built to function under challenging conditions. It has already received the CE mark for non-hazardous environments and we have planned for North American certification for hazardous environments. However, the ATEX and IECEx certification is accepted globally by many of our target industries operating in challenging environments.”

About the IRmadillo™, an in situ production FTIR Spectrometer

The IRmadillo™ is a rugged FTIR (mid-infrared) spectrometer that provides real-time reaction analysis for better process monitoring and control in manufacturing environments. A novel and vibration-tolerant analytical instrument, the IRmadillo™ spectrometer is compact, lighter and significantly more robust than existing FTIRs. Unlike any other FTIR, the Keit instrument can be mounted directly onto manufacturing vessels or connected to process lines enabling continuous, real-time reaction analysis of liquids and slurries.
